Output 62814b39cbf778794681fb029e2872c09009ddc94fe49df32eba7f27a6ef0adb:13

value
52616089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a0438e54a3f765f9e07c20704d04b0ce257945 OP_EQUAL
address
3NdAeoYPRmiyysapyQufikGRkQMMQqQLUz
transaction
62814b39cbf778794681fb029e2872c09009ddc94fe49df32eba7f27a6ef0adb
spent
true